What color is 567DA5?

The RGB color code for color number #567DA5 is RGB(86, 125, 165). In the RGB color model, #567DA5 has a red value of 86, a green value of 125, and a blue value of 165. The CMYK color model (also known as process color, used in color printing) comprises 47.9% cyan, 24.2% magenta, 0.0% yellow, and 35.3% key (black). The HSL color scale has a hue of 210.4° (degrees), 31.5 % saturation, and 49.2 % lightness. In the HSB/HSV color space, #567DA5 has a hue of 210.4° (degrees), 47.9 % saturation and 64.7 % brightness/value.

What is the LRV of #567DA5? (For interior and product design)

567DA5 has an LRV of nearly 19. By LRV value, it is a medium dark color.

Light Reflectance Value (LRV) is a measure of how much visible light is reflected off a surface. It is a number on a scale of 0 to 100, with 0 being pure black and 100 being pure white. The higher the LRV, the more light the color reflects and the lighter it will appear.

Is #567DA5 Readable? WCAG Contrast Checker (For digital design)

Check if the color 567DA5 meets Web Content Accessibility Guidelines (WCAG) standards, minimum contrast ratio standards between text and background colors. The WCAG (Web Content Accessibility Guidelines) provides global standards for readable web content.

WCAG Recommendations - Large Text: above 18pt or 14pt bold. Normal Text: below 18pt or 14pt bold.

  • Minimum contrast ratio (AA): 4.5 for normal text and 3 for large text.
  • Enhanced contrast ratio (AAA): 7 for normal text and 4.5 for large text.

Complementary / Opposite Color

Complementary colors are pairs of colors which, when combined or mixed, cancel each other out (lose hue) by producing a grayscale color like white or black. When placed next to each other, they create the strongest contrast for those two colors. Complementary colors also called opposite colors. Complementary color schemes are created using two opposite colors on the color wheel. The examples are red–cyan, green–magenta, and blue–yellow.
